The WIn32 version of pg_dumpall doesn't work well. When I start it, it gives the following error: pg_dumpall.exe: running """C:/Prog/Copy of PostgreSQL/bin/pg_dump.exe" -v -Fp ' evidencija''"'" Password: pg_dump.exe: [archiver (db)] connection to database "'evidencija'''" failed: FAT AL: database "'evidencija'''" does not exist pg_dump.exe: *** aborted because of error pg_dumpall.exe: pg_dump failed on database "evidencija", exiting It seems like it tries to connect to the database in order to dump it, but it gives 'evidencija''' as dbname instead of evidencija. The similar thing happens when you start to pg_dumpall as some other user (not pgsql) but give the username on command line (-U option). It tries to connect to the database as user 'pgsql' and not pgsql. Would you try to fix it? Thx.
